### Snapshot Testing Check

When reviewing UI changes to the Quillboard component library, confirm that every modified component has a regenerated snapshot committed alongside it. Stale snapshots are the most common cause of red pipelines on the main branch. Reject any diff where snapshots were updated without a visual change noted in the description. The snapshot runner reads the following configuration values at startup.

deployment values, faduf-tawep:
SORDOR_LOG_LEVEL=error
SORDOR_METRICS_HOST=metrics.sordor.nelvrolabs.internal
SORDOR_POOL_SIZE=4

# Basement Archive Room — Night Access

The archive room under Pellworth House holds old contracts and the tape backups. Night shift: take stairwell C, not the lift (it's switched off after midnight). Lights are on a timer by the door — slap the button as you go in. Sign the logbook, even at 3am, yes really. The keypad by the door takes the code below.

staff pass of fahap-tajeg = bdg-FT-6

## ParcelPing Webhook Setup

Releases must verify webhook delivery before sign-off. Point staging at the TraceLoop endpoint, fire a synthetic scan event, and confirm the `delivered` status lands within 5s. Retries: 3, exponential backoff. Failures page the Dray team. The verification script authenticates against the internal TraceLoop relay with the key below.

API key for tagug-tajef: vxb4-R1fo

**Alert: LargeDiff render timeout (Spanview)**

The Spanview diff viewer aborted rendering because a file exceeded the 40 MB streaming threshold. Plugin hooks registered on `diff.render` were skipped for this file; partial hunks may still have fired. This is expected behavior, not data loss. If your plugin depends on full-file diffs, request an allowlist entry from the Spanview team at the address below.

pager mailbox: silael.sorwyn.tamius@zemvarsys.corp